Theme Ideas

1. Enchanted Garden

Transform your party space into a whimsical garden with pastel-colored balloons, floral arrangements, and a "Little Princess" banner. Use fake flowers and petals to create a beautiful and budget-friendly backdrop.

2. Vintage Rose

Create a classic and elegant atmosphere with a vintage rose theme. Use lace, ribbons, and soft pink hues to create a romantic setting. You can also use recycled materials like old doors, windows, and furniture to add a touch of nostalgia.

3. Sweet Treats

Celebrate the arrival of baby girl with a sweet treats theme. Decorate with candy-themed decorations, cupcakes, and a "Sugar and Spice" banner. You can also have a candy buffet with affordable candies and treats.

Decorations on a Budget

1. DIY Pompoms

Create a stunning backdrop with DIY pompoms made from tissue paper. You can hang them from the ceiling or attach them to a wall to create a colorful and festive atmosphere.

2. Borrow and Repurpose

Ask friends and family to lend you decorations, vases, and other items to reduce costs. Repurpose items like mason jars, tea cups, and fabric scraps to create unique centerpieces and decorations.

3. Printables and Templates

Use free printables and templates available online to create your own decorations, invitations, and games. You can customize them to fit your theme and style.

Food and Drinks on a Budget

1. Finger Foods

Serve finger foods like sandwiches, fruit kebabs, and cheese and crackers to reduce costs. You can also have a potluck where guests bring their favorite dishes to share.

2. Dessert Table

Create a stunning dessert table with affordable treats like cupcakes, cookies, and candies. You can also have a "Cake Decorating Station" where guests can decorate their own cupcakes.

3. Refreshments

Serve refreshing drinks like lemonade, iced tea, and flavored water to keep your guests hydrated. You can also have a "Mom-osa Bar" with affordable champagne and juices.

Games and Activities

1. Guess the Baby Food

Prepare several baby food jars with different flavors and have guests guess the flavors. The one who guesses the most correctly wins a prize.

2. Baby Shower Bingo

Create bingo cards with baby-related items and have guests mark them off as they're revealed during the game. The first one to get five in a row wins.

3. Pin the Pacifier

Play a baby-themed spin on the classic "Pin the Tail on the Donkey" game. Create a large picture of a baby, and have guests take turns blindfolded and try to pin a pacifier on the baby's mouth.
